ug编程能做些什么
-
UG编程是指使用UG软件进行编程,UG软件是一款广泛应用于机械设计、数字化样机、数控编程、模具设计、工装设计等领域的三维设计软件。UG编程可以实现以下功能:
-
机械设计:UG编程可以用于进行机械零部件的设计和装配。通过UG编程,可以绘制机械零部件的三维模型,进行装配分析和运动仿真,快速设计各种复杂的机械产品。
-
数字化样机:UG编程可以将设计图纸转换为三维模型,通过UG软件的切削仿真功能,可以准确模拟出样机的加工过程,进而对产品进行检测和修改。
-
数控编程:UG编程可以生成开发数控编程代码,用于控制加工机床进行自动化生产。通过UG编程,可以准确计算加工路径和切削参数,提高加工效率和精度。
-
模具设计:UG编程可以用于模具的设计和制造。通过UG编程,可以快速生成模具的三维模型和图纸,进行模具流程分析和碰撞检测,提高模具的质量和制造效率。
-
工装设计:UG编程可以用于工装的设计和制造。通过UG编程,可以绘制工装的三维模型和图纸,进行工装装配仿真和工装夹具设计,提高生产线的效率和质量。
综上所述,UG编程可以应用于机械设计、数控编程、模具设计、工装设计等领域,可以实现各种复杂产品的快速设计和制造,提高生产效率和质量。
1年前 -
-
UG编程(Unigraphics编程)是一种用于CAD/CAM(计算机辅助设计与制造)软件的自动化编程技术。UG是一款流行的三维计算机辅助设计软件,许多制造公司使用它进行产品设计和制造。UG编程可以实现许多功能和任务,下面是一些UG编程能够做到的事情。
-
零件设计和建模:UG编程可以用于创建和修改三维实体模型。它可以用于创建各种零件设计,包括轴承、齿轮、管道等等。UG编程能够进行几何建模、形状设计、参数化建模等操作。使用UG编程,设计师可以创建复杂的零件模型并进行快速的设计修改。
-
装配模型和运动分析:UG编程可以用于创建装配模型和进行动力学分析。它可以帮助设计师将零件组装在一起并模拟它们的运动。UG编程可以计算文件中包含的零件之间的相对位置和约束关系,并模拟它们的运动。这对于设计团队来说非常有用,因为它可以帮助他们检查设计的合理性并进行必要的修改。
-
数控编程:UG编程可以用于创建数控(NC)程序,用于指导数控机床完成零件的加工。UG编程能够将零件模型转化为相应的数控指令,包括切削工具路径、速度、进给率等等。数控编程可以提高生产效率,避免人工误差,并提高零件加工的准确性和精度。
-
翻模和模具设计:UG编程可以用于翻模和模具设计。翻模是用来制造复杂形状零件的工艺,UG编程可以帮助设计师创建翻模的几何形状和切割路径。模具设计是用于制造产品的模具,UG编程可以帮助设计师创建模具零件和装配,并生成相应的数控编程。
-
可视化和渲染:UG编程还可以用于可视化和渲染,使设计师和客户能够更好地理解和评估设计。UG编程可以生成逼真的三维渲染图像,呈现设计的外观和细节。这对于进行设计评审、产品宣传和市场推广非常有用。
总之,UG编程是一种强大的工具,可以用于建模、装配、运动分析、数控编程、翻模、模具设计和可视化等各种CAD/CAM任务。它可以帮助制造公司提高设计效率、减少人为错误,从而提高产品质量和生产效率。
1年前 -
-
UG软件(也称为Siemens NX)是一种主要用于机械设计、工程分析和制造的三维建模软件。UG编程是指使用UG软件的API(应用程序接口)和编程语言来自动化和定制化各种机械设计和制造流程。UG编程能够实现以下功能:
-
参数化建模:使用UG编程,可以根据用户定义的参数和规则,自动创建具有变化和灵活性的三维模型。这样的参数化建模可以大大提高设计效率,减少人工操作和错误。
-
自动化CAD操作:UG编程可以用来编写脚本,以自动执行各种CAD操作,如创建零件、装配、绘图、布局等。这样就可以节省大量的时间和精力,特别是在重复和繁琐的任务中。
-
工艺规划和验证:UG编程可以用来创建自定义的工艺规划和验证工具,以确保制造过程的准确性和可行性。例如,可以编写程序来生成CNC加工路径、模拟工艺装配过程、分析和优化工艺参数等。
-
数据交换和集成:UG编程可以用来编写程序来实现UG软件与其他软件之间的数据交换和集成。这样就可以轻松地将设计数据与ERP、PLM、CAM等系统进行集成,实现高效的协同设计和制造。
-
用户界面定制:UG编程可以用来开发自定义的用户界面,以满足特定的用户需求。通过编写插件和宏,可以在UG软件中添加新的功能和工具,提高用户的设计和操作体验。
UG编程可以使用多种编程语言来实现,包括C++、C#、VB.NET等。UG软件提供了丰富的API和开发环境,使得UG编程变得相对容易和灵活。但是,需要具备一定的编程知识和对UG软件的深入理解才能进行有效的UG编程。
1年前 -